About 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one
2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one (PubChem CID 110725162) has the molecular formula C16H16F4N2O2
and a molecular weight of 344.31 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one.

What is the SMILES notation for 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one?
The canonical SMILES for 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one is O=C(C1CCN(C(=O)C(F)(F)F)CC1)N1CCc2cccc(F)c21.
What is the InChIKey of 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one?
The InChIKey is VIMOVCUMSCGIAV-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C16H16F4N2O2/c17-12-3-1-2-10-6-9-22(13(10)12)14(23)11-4-7-21(8-5-11)15(24)16(18,19)20/h1-3,11H,4-9H2.
What are the key properties of 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one?
2,2,2-trifluoro-1-[4-(7-fluoro-2,3-dihydroindole-1-carbonyl)piperidin-1-yl]ethanone has a molecular weight of 344.31 g/mol, XLogP of 2.52, 1 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 2 hydrogen bond acceptors.
